Output 51e7dce30bd426e8960fe76d9140cee3c642b8eaf236e42a82ede3cdc50c757b:9

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67f86ac78500a378365b5a7736aac55d10edd5b0 OP_EQUAL
address
3BAm7dELNndsqkHxzv4uRH23eR74ZKPACK
transaction
51e7dce30bd426e8960fe76d9140cee3c642b8eaf236e42a82ede3cdc50c757b
confirmations
296685
spent
true